Woodpeckers often target homes with exposed wood siding, trees, or wooden structures, creating holes and causing deterioration over time. Their activity can lead to weakened walls, compromised insulation, and increased vulnerability to weather elements. Additionally, persistent pecking can disturb homeowners and attract unwanted pests, such as insects or other animals seeking shelter in the holes. What are the signs of a woodpecker infestation? Signs include persistent tapping sounds on wood surfaces, visible holes or holes with sawdust at the base, and damaged or frayed wood around the affected areas.
How do local contractors typically remove woodpeckers? They often use methods such as installing visual deterrents, applying sound devices, or modifying the habitat to make the area less attractive to woodpeckers.
Are there any preventive measures to keep woodpeckers away? Yes, contractors may recommend installing physical barriers, applying visual scare devices, or making habitat adjustments to reduce attractants around the property.
What types of damage can woodpeckers cause? Woodpeckers can create large holes in siding, eaves, and wooden structures, which may lead to wood decay or provide entry points for pests.
